Output 438da2d8084c7866f5fc3bbfa2d82eba6d8c0e5e2a49f5b3ff844b6671d6fc61:18

value
53094896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e423c652a36fc4da325fb643c14e90644d6793d OP_EQUAL
address
MDaMUUZThfaEt9uS26Krezf7JJJkeSgAwH
transaction
438da2d8084c7866f5fc3bbfa2d82eba6d8c0e5e2a49f5b3ff844b6671d6fc61
spent
true